Transaction 05ab3cf7ae69d364d0795071621626c07b0716fb3af1c9541668644c3139e56d

2 Input
2 Outputs
  • 05ab3cf7ae69d364d0795071621626c07b0716fb3af1c9541668644c3139e56d:0
  • value  198660000
    address  157RyX95NxYe4wm5AZLrF8KAY3gpzdVpwt
  • 05ab3cf7ae69d364d0795071621626c07b0716fb3af1c9541668644c3139e56d:1
  • value  116551466
    address  1KumbRsTcA6UNqU2MHEfqEFnAZYU3w3izR